Comprehending the Italian Pharmacy System (Farmacia)
When trying to find medication in Italy, your first location is a Farmacia, easily determined by a radiant green or red cross indication outside. Italian pharmacists are extremely trained healthcare experts who study for numerous years. They are distinctively placed to examine small ailments and recommend the proper over the counter (OTC) medicine.
Unlike in some nations where fundamental painkillers are sold in supermarkets, gasoline station, or corner store, all medical products in Italy need to be purchased inside a licensed pharmacy.
Category of Drugs in Italy
To comprehend what you can purchase without a medical professional's note, it assists to know how Italy categorizes medications:
SOP (Senza Obbligo di Prescrizione): Non-prescription drugs that can be shown on drug store shelves or requested directly over-the-counter.OTC (Over The Counter): A subset of SOP drugs that manufacturers are legally enabled to advertise straight to the public. Medicinali con Ricetta: Prescription-only medications. These consist of more powerful pain relievers, opioids, and specialized anti-inflammatory drugs.Common Pain Killers Available Over-the-Counter in Italy
If you need mild-to-moderate pain relief, you do not require to go to a physician. You can just stroll into a farmacia and ask the pharmacist.
Below is a table outlining the most common active components, their Italian brand, and what they are normally utilized for:
Table of Common Non-Prescription Pain Killers in ItalyActive IngredientTypical Italian Brand NamesMain UseNotesParacetamolTachipirina, EfferalganModerate pain, fever, headachesMost safe for pregnant women and children (dose differs).IbuprofenBrufen, Moment, NurofenSwelling, muscle discomfort, dental pain, headachesPrevent if you have stomach ulcers or kidney concerns.Aspirin (Acetylsalicylic Acid)AspirinaDiscomfort, fever, swellingNot advised for kids or teenagers due to Reye's syndrome danger.NaproxenSynflex, MomendolLonger-lasting muscle and joint discomfortReliable for duration cramps and arthritis flare-ups.
Tip: When asking the pharmacist, it is often more efficient to utilize the active ingredient (e.g., "Paracetamolo" or "Ibuprofene") instead of an American or British brand name, as brands vary by country.
What You Can not Purchase Without a Prescription
While basic NSAIDs (Non-Steroidal Anti-Inflammatory Drugs) and paracetamol are easily offered, Italy maintains rigorous regulations relating to stronger compounds. You can not purchase the following without a doctor's prescription (ricetta medica):
Strong Opioids: Medications like tramadol, codeine-heavy formulations, morphine, and oxycodone.Prescription-Strength NSAIDs: Higher doses of anti-inflammatories that go beyond OTC limits.Muscle Relaxants: Oral muscle relaxants frequently require a physician's assessment to eliminate underlying concerns.Triptans: Medications particularly for extreme migraines (though some milder formulas are strictly controlled, most require a script).
If you require these medications, you must visit a regional doctor, an immediate care center (Guardia Medica), or an emergency clinic (Pronto Soccorso).

Can I purchase pain relievers in Italian grocery stores or convenience stores?
No. By Italian law, all medical items-- even fundamental paracetamol-- can just be offered inside a certified drug store (farmacia or parafarmacia).
2. Can I use my foreign prescription in Italy?
If you have a prescription from another European Union (EU) or European Economic Area (EEA) nation, it is normally legitimate in Italy. If you are going to from outside the EU (e.g., the US, Canada, or Australia), your foreign paper prescription will not be legally acknowledged by Italian pharmacists for limited drugs. You will require to see an Italian physician to get a local prescription.

4. What should I do if my pain is serious and drug stores are closed?
If you are experiencing severe discomfort beyond regular company hours and can not wait on a routine drug store to open, look for a Farmacia di Turno (on-call pharmacy). For outright emergency situations, dial 112 (the universal European emergency number) or check out the Pronto Soccorso (Emergency Room) at the closest health center.
